fre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

c鏈表基本操作-在線瀏覽

2024-08-10 16:16本頁面
  

【正文】 } {amp。 { p=pnext。 { snext=p。 } pnext=s。 } }}4. 鏈表結(jié)點的刪除如果要在鏈表中刪除結(jié)點a并釋放被刪除的結(jié)點所占的存儲空間,則需要考慮下列幾種情況。(2)若要刪除的結(jié)點a存在于鏈表中,但不是第一個結(jié)點,則應使a得上一個結(jié)點a_k1的指針域指向a的下一個結(jié)點a_k+1。void list::deletelist(int aDate) //設aDate是要刪除的結(jié)點a中的數(shù)據(jù)成員{Node*p,*q。if(p==NULL) //若是空表return。delete p。amp。p=pnext。delete p。Node*next。class list{Node*head。}void insertlist(int aData,int bData)。void outputlist()。}}。 //p指向結(jié)點a,q指向結(jié)點a_k,s指向結(jié)點bs=(Node*)new(Node)。 //設b為此結(jié)點p=head。snext=NULL。head=s。amp。p=pnext。snext=p。snext=NULL。 //p用于指向結(jié)點a,q用于指向結(jié)a的前一個結(jié)點p=head。if(pData==aData) //若a是第一個結(jié)點{head=pnext。}else{while(pData!=aDataamp。pnext!=NULL) //查找結(jié)點a{q=p。}if(pData==aData) //若有結(jié)點a{qnext=pnext。}}}void list::outputlist(){Node*current=head。current=currentnext。}void main(){list A,B。(0,Data[0])。i10。 //順序向后插入cout\n鏈表A:。(Data[7])。()。 //建立鏈表B首結(jié)點for(i=0。i++)(()Data,Data[i])。()。cout刪除元素67后。}程序運行結(jié)果為鏈表A;25,41,16,98,5,67,9,55,1,121刪除元素Data[7]后;25,41,16,98,5,67,9,1,121鏈表B;121,1,55,9,67,5,98,16,41,25,刪除元素67后;121,1,55,9,5,98,16,41,25,下面是楊輝三角的代碼:include iostreaminclude iomanipusing namespace std。int i,j,a[n][n]。in。a[i][1]=1。in。j=i1。}for(i=1。i++){for(j=1。j++)coutsetw(5)a[i][j] 。}coutendl。}include iostream,h include struct Node{}。 int n=0。 Node *p1,*p2,*head。 p1=p2=new Node。 cinp1num。 head=NULL。 while (p1num!=0) if (n==1) head=p1。 } p2next=NULL。 return head。 int count=0。 p=pnext。}int Search(Node amp。 int index=0。 p=pnext。 } return 0。 Node* p=head。 while (p) coutpnum 。 p=pnext。 }}void Destruct(Node *head) //清空鏈表{ while (current) temp = current。 current = current next。
點擊復制文檔內(nèi)容
醫(yī)療健康相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1